Alan Turing was once a hero in England.

Then, in 1952, Turing was outed, leading to a very public trial, conviction and chemically castrated for “gross indecency.” He killed himself two years later.

Now, 60 years on, the British government is honoring Turing by including him in a series of twelve new “Britons of Distinction” stamps set to be released next month.

George Broadhead, secretary of the Humanist group the Pink Triangle Trust, celebrated Turing’s inclusion in a press release. “This is richly deserved,” he wrote. “It is well known that Turing was gay, but perhaps not so well known that he was a staunch atheist. There are many other famous gay atheists past and present — Christopher Marlowe, Maynard Keynes, Stephen Fry and and Michael Cashman among them — but Turing is probably the most notable since his breaking of the Enigma Code went such a long way in saving the UK from defeat in the last war.”

Though Turing’s picture is not featured on the new stamp – one of his eponymous machines is, instead – the news is just the latest step in a decades-long effort to redeem Turing’s image. Perhaps the biggest development came in 2009, when then-Prime Minister Gordon Brown issued an official apology for Turing’s treatment.

“While Mr Turing was dealt with under the law of the time and we can’t put the clock back, his treatment was of course utterly unfair and I am pleased to have the chance to say how deeply sorry I and we all are for what happened to him,” Brown said at the time. “Alan and the many thousands of other gay men who were convicted, as he was convicted, under homophobic laws, were treated terribly.

A new petition is now asking that the government to offer an official posthumous pardon for Turing. One of Turing’s supporters, programmer John Graham-Cumming, actually opposes this petition, because it still assumes other gay men convicted under since-scrapped laws were guilty of something wrong.

“You either pardon all the gay men convicted (including, most importantly, those that are still living with criminal convictions) or you do nothing,” he contended last month.

Family and friends of slain Portuguese journalist Carlos Castro honored the dead man’s wishes yesterday by pouring his ashes down a subway grate in Times Square.

A funeral was held in Newark yesterday for Castro, 65, who was allegedly castrated with a corkscrew by his 20-year-old lover, male model Renato Seabra, on Jan. 7 in a room at the InterContinental Hotel in Times Square.

After the service, his sisters and a friend took a limo to Broadway and 43rd Street and quickly dumped his ashes without saying a word, said photographer Leandro Badalotti.

Fernanda Castro and Maria Amelia Castro kneeled down and poured the ashes of their brother, Carlos Castro, into the grate at W. 44th St. and Broadway as onlookers walked by. Some of the ashes scattered into the wind at ‘The Crossroads of the World.’ …Friends said the family got permission from the city to leave Castro’s ashes in Times Square. Castro wrote about his desire to have them spread there in his biography.’”

Prominent gay rights activist and journalist Carlos De Castro was found brutally murdered in his New York City hotel room on Friday. According to reports, police have the 65-year-old’s younger lover in custody. 20-year-old Renato Seabra, a male model from Portugal, is currently being held at Bellevue Hospital Center.

The New York Times gives a run down on the discovery of the crime scene:

“On Friday, a friend of Mr. De Castro’s from New Jersey grew concerned and went to the hotel, near 44th Street and Eighth Avenue, to check on him. Members of the hotel’s security staff found Mr. De Castro’s body. ‘There’s some type of sexual mutilation,’ the official said. ‘The place was a mess.’ Detectives seized a laptop from the room.”

“Mr. De Castro’s friend told the police that she had seen Mr. Seabra in the lobby on Friday and that she had last spoken to Mr. De Castro about 12:30 p.m. that day. Investigators distributed a wanted poster, describing Mr. Seabra as a person of interest.”

Disturbingly, it is being reported that Castro had not only been bludgeoned to death but that his scrotum had also been cut off.
